This is more than a story about a legendary cheesecake in the Bronx. S&S Cheesecake was founded by holocaust survivor Fred Schuster in 1962, 21 years after he was forced to flee his home country of Germany. Fred is now 97 years old, but he was able to come in to the bakery to tell us his story first-hand; and to taste a slice, for quality-testing purposes.
“Don’t gild the lily,” is the advice he’s given to his son-in-law, who now operates the business. Accordingly, the recipe and process has gone unchanged for 6 decades. 🤯
